According to the Deputy Minister of Economic Development, Trade and Agriculture Taras Vysotsky, Ukraine is supplying food to over 150 million people globally, while having its own population at just over 40 million.
This number could be doubled if Ukraine starts vividly integrating innovation technologies in food production, attracting more investments in the agri sector, and actively engaging into the global food supply chains.
Even in challenging times of pandemic Ukraine remains a reliable trade partner for countries that are in demand for agricultural products.
